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Insomnia inclusion criteria: (1) Meet the diagnostic criteria of western medicine for insomnia; (2) Aged 18-80 years; (3) Consciousness, clear thinking, and use of language to communicate; (4)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index > 5; (5) The subjects voluntarily participate in the clinical trial and sign the informed consent form, and the procedure meets the requirements of GCP. 2. Depression included in the case criteria: (1) Meet the diagnostic criteria for depression; (2) Gender is not limited, aged >= 18 year; (3) Able to independently complete the questionnaire, give informed consent and participate voluntarily. 3. Subthreshold depression included in the case criteria: (1) Meet the diagnostic criteria for subthreshold depression, the Central Epidemiological Survey Depression Scale (CES-D) score >= 16 points, and the Hamilton Depression Scale (HAMD-17) score: 7 points = 18 years; (3) Able to independently complete the questionnaire, give informed consent and participate voluntarily. 4. Mild cognitive impairment included in the case criteria: (1) Meet the MCI diagnostic criteria; (2) MoCA score < 26, if the years of education <= 12 years, add 1 point to the score; (3) Aged between 50 and 80 years; (4) Sign the inform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Exclusion criteria for insomnia cases: (1) All systemic diseases such as pain, fever, cough, surgery, etc., as well as insomnia caused by external environmental interference factors; (2) Severe mental illness that affects sleep, such as: sch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, paranoid disorder, schizoaffective disorder, mental disorder caused by epilepsy, and severe mental retardation; (3) Those who are pregnant, breastfeeding and those who plan to become pregnant; (4) Those who are allergic to aromatic drugs or have a history of severe adverse reactions, and those with severe allergic constitution; (5) Those with other serious diseases of the circulatory system, hematopoietic system, digestive system, endocrine system, etc.; (6) Those who are participating in clinical trials of other drugs. 2. Subthreshold depression and exclusion criteria for depression: (1) Patients with previous psychotic disorder or organic mental disorder; (2) Depressive episodes caused by psychoactive substances and non-addictive substances; (3) Those who are pregnant, breastfeeding and those who plan to become pregnant; (4) Known history of alcoholism, drug addiction or other drug abuse; (5) The patient has a strong suicide attempt or behavior; (6) Patients who refuse to complete the collection of any observational index. 3. Exclusion criteria for mild cognitive impairment: (1) Dementia patients or those taking anti-dementia drugs; (2) Cognitive impairment caused by acute cerebrovascular disease, brain atrophy, thyroid, anemia, inflammation, etc.; (3) Have a history of severe alcohol or drug abuse; (4) Cognitive impairment caused by depression; (5) Cognitive dysfunction due to other reasons such as poisoning or drugs.
